TEN-T
Also called: Trans-European Transport Network TEN-T is the European Union's trans-European transport network covering major transport corridors, nodes and connections across Europe. AFIR uses the TEN-T road network as a basis for binding EV charging-infrastructure deployment targets. The regulation sets requirements for charging pools serving light-duty and heavy-duty vehicles at specified intervals and with minimum power levels as the network develops. TEN-T is therefore a location and infrastructure-planning concept rather than a charging technology. Its relevance to an EVSE supplier comes from where AFIR requires charging capacity to be deployed.
